OK...let me play devil's advocate
Why couldn't the Kappa chassis spawn a Corvette. The chassis are very similar in design and function. The Kappa chassis looks like a slightly smaller Y-body. There is no really good reason the Kappa chassis could not be used for an entry level V6 Corvette.
Wilmington HAS the extra capacity for more Kappas to be built...something like 125,000 more
Lets say Chevy makes this kappa Corvette with a design very similar to the 2004 Nomad concept (I'm not talking wagon, the front end) Very C1 in style. With a HF V6 it would be a very decent performer with killer looks and I would assume a profitable car if priced around 30k.
Target market...
Corvette owners who want an extra toy that it very much an attention getter
Baby boomers who grew up with the C1
Those who don't have enough to get a new vette but could afford this.
Entry level vette =
